Zucchini Noodle Stir-Fry with Garlic and Lemon
A light, refreshing alternative to pasta featuring spiralized zucchini sautéed in garlic and lemon-infused olive oil for a satisfying Whole30 meal. Ingredients
- 4 medium zucchini
- 3 tbsp olive oil
- 4 cloves garlic
- 1/2 lemon
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 2 tbsp fresh basil
Instructions
- Step 1: Spiralize 4 medium zucchini into noodles, then b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add zucchini noodles and blanch for 2 minutes until vibrant green and slightly tender, then drain thoroughly in a colander.
- Step 2: Heat 3 tablespoons ol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at, then add 4 minced garlic cloves and sauté for 30 seconds until fragrant and golden (do not brown).
- Step 3: Add drained zucchini noodles to the skillet along with zest and juice from 1/2 lemon, 1/2 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on black pepper. Toss for 2-3 minutes until heated through and coated, then sprinkle with 2 tablespoons chopped fresh basil and serve immediately.

How do I store leftover Zucchini Noodle Stir-Fry with Garlic and Lemon?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ep medium zucchini from drying out.
